Pair of Late 19th Century Italian Carved Giltwood folding Table Easels, circa 1890

An elegant and highly decorative pair of Italian giltwood folding table easels, dating from the late nineteenth century, circa 1890. Beautifully carved in the Rococo Revival taste, each easel features an elaborate pierced foliate crest centred by a carved roundel, above a graceful lyre-form frame terminating in a beaded picture ledge and scrolling feet.

Each 24cm wide, 15cm deep, 36cm high

Retaining their original gilt surface, the easels have acquired a rich, mellow patina over more than a century, with gentle wear that enhances their authentic character. The folding rear supports allow them to be adjusted for display, making them ideal for paintings, icons, photographs, mirrors, books or decorative plaques.

Both sculptural and functional, these finely carved easels epitomise the exuberant craftsmanship of late nineteenth-century Italian decorative arts. Their elegant proportions and warm gilded finish make them equally at home in classical, eclectic and contemporary interiors.
